Help for Health Center

Ensuring basic medical care for one year

Location: Ban Na, Laos
Local project partner: direct help

As part of the visit to the Ban Na Primary School, Tarek Mamisch subsequently visited the nearby Ban Na health station. This small medical facility is responsible not only for the entire village but also for the surrounding communities and often represents the only medical point of contact for the local population.

A particular focus of the health station is on maternity care as well as medical treatment for infants and children. At the same time, adults and elderly people from the village and the surrounding region are also treated here.

On site, it became clear that the health station had completely run out of medicines. Adequate medical care was therefore no longer ensured. In order to provide fast and unbureaucratic support, all urgently needed medicines were immediately procured to cover the medical care of patients for an entire year.

The medicines were purchased from a large wholesale pharmacy and subsequently provided to the health station. The total cost of this measure amounted to 2,675 US-Dollars.

Through this project, basic medical care for Ban Na and the surrounding villages could be sustainably secured. It once again demonstrates how important flexible and direct assistance is in order to respond to acute emergencies and, in particular, to ensure the care of mothers and children.

Amount of funding in 2026: 2,675 US-Dollars
